Transaction 3c5f663895fe885748e6bdc3566e8f0c89a95dfa817ae69350a7486aedf79e3c
1 Input
1 Output
-
3c5f663895fe885748e6bdc3566e8f0c89a95dfa817ae69350a7486aedf79e3c:0
- value
- 1291302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bffe42ad9952b17ee0b57e8b3e4a14af9c5d7732 OP_EQUAL
- address
- 3KCBaWXfwGAjikA4RSzi2CFZQSHju3ABhM